The extremely strict Dwarven laws over who could learn Dwarvish (dwarves only) guaranteed that dwarves could openly discuss strategy in front of their enemies, as long as they weren’t fellow dwarves. Some countries had come to consider a dwarf speaking Dwarvish to be an act of war and had, thus far, been spot on. It was the linguistic equivalent of a crossbow being cocked.
